Output be62f364dcc40c53b220bfdc5ca2cdb0bc8befef01b78b76da179e185bfb6486:3

value
44950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aff6668ebda5f407b53200c00ac6e677a237a59d OP_EQUAL
address
3HjRML2xFaB8QTuzkoyuWPpuAvDmivRBGt
transaction
be62f364dcc40c53b220bfdc5ca2cdb0bc8befef01b78b76da179e185bfb6486
confirmations
338193
spent
true